Abstract
Agricultural irrigation includes braiding layer and liner layer with braiding water delivery soft ribbons, including tube wall and the water transport channel that is formed by tube wall, the tube wall, and the braiding layer is located at the liner layer periphery and is closely connected with the liner layer.The present invention is light-weight, cost is low, pliability is good, and wearability is strong, good weatherability, is mainly used for agricultural irrigation water delivery field, it can also be used to which industry, mine drainage are used.
Description
Technical field
The present invention relates to a kind of water delivery soft ribbons, more particularly to a kind of agricultural irrigation of braiding water delivery soft ribbons.
Background technology
In the prior art, the pipeline of plastic extruding forming manufacture is usually used in the pipeline for agricultural irrigation conveying water,
Pipe wall is thicker, and raw materials are more, and weight weight, cost is higher, in use, it is necessary to larger vehicle transport, transhipment
Inconvenience, labor intensity is big in installation process, expends more machinery, manpower and material resources, and cracky, wearability after colliding
Difference;The prior art also has using expressing technique production thin-walled aqueduct, although these thin-walled aqueduct tube walls compared with
It is thin, but tube wall hardness is larger, pliability is poor, and rhegma easy to break is bad under low-temperature condition, and weatherability is poor, and is not easy to coil, storage
It is inconvenient with transport.
The content of the invention
The object of the present invention is to provide it is a kind of it is light-weight, cost is low, pliability is good, wearability is strong, the agricultural of good weatherability
Irrigate with braiding water delivery soft ribbons.
To achieve the above object, it is as follows to solve the technical solution that technical problem uses by the present invention:Agricultural irrigation braiding is defeated
Water soft ribbons, including tube wall and the water transport channel that is formed by tube wall, the tube wall include braiding layer and liner layer, and the braiding layer is set
Closely it is connected in the liner layer periphery and with the liner layer;
The braiding layer is made of warp and weft braiding, and the warp is made of flat filament layer, and the weft is by filament
Layer is formed;
The liner layer is entity coextruded layer, is integrally formed by plastic extrusion process, has the function that water delivery, antiseepage;
The liner layer thickness is 0.1-0.8mm;
The braiding layer thickness is 0.1-1.0mm;
Further improve, the warp is made of filament layer, and the weft is made of flat filament layer;
Further improve, the warp and the weft are formed by flat filament layer;
Further improve, the warp and the weft are formed by filament layer;
Further improve, the warp is made of multilayer flat filament layer, flat filament layer and the liner close to liner layer side
The close connection of layer, remaining described each flat filament layer have the function that the protection liner layer, and each layer flat filament layer can be that plastics PE is flat
One or several kinds of combinations in silk layer, PVC flat filaments layer, PET flat filaments layer, PE flat filaments layer, Polyster ribbon-like filament layer;
Further improve, the weft is made of multi-layer fiber layer, can so increase the pliability of the tube wall and wear-resisting
Property, the multi-layer fiber layer includes one or several kinds of combinations in polyester fiber layer, PET fiber layer, polypropylene fiber layer;
Further improve, the liner layer is closely connected and composed by multi-layer body coextruded layer, close to the braiding layer side
The entity coextruded layer be closely connected with the braiding layer, away from the braiding layer side the entity coextruded layer formed institute
Water transport channel is stated, the multi-layer body coextruded layer includes plastic pvc entity coextruded layer, PET entities coextruded layer, PE entity coextruded layers
In one or several kinds of combinations, will not be outer because of external force, temperature etc. when so described braiding layer is connected with the liner layer
The influence of boundary's factor makes the liner layer form the entity coextruded layer damage of the water transport channel or even perforate, and is so not easy
Leakage, water delivery effect are good;
Further improve, reinforcing layer is equipped between the braiding layer and the liner layer, the reinforcing layer is used for improving institute
The hardness of agricultural irrigation braiding water delivery soft ribbons is stated, is conducive to that various fillings are installed with braiding water delivery soft ribbons in the agricultural irrigation
The accessory irrigate;
The reinforcing layer thickness is 0.1-1.0mm;
Further improve, the reinforcing layer is the reinforcing band circumferentially distributed and axially extending along tube wall, so can root
Set according to the position of accessory installation and reinforce band, without in the circumferentially continuous setting of the tube wall, saving raw material, raising production effect
Rate;
The reinforcing tape thickness is 0.1-1.0mm, width 20-100mm.
Further improve, the reinforcing band, so can be circumferentially same in the tube wall along the circumferentially-spaced distribution of the tube wall
When the accessories of a variety of irrigations is set, a plurality of aqueduct can be made to be mutually combined connection according to arrangement form, position, increase is defeated
The diversity of water system;
Further improve, the reinforcing is taken equipped with the peace being axially distributed with braiding water delivery soft ribbons along the agricultural irrigation
Hole is filled, the mounting hole penetrates through the tube wall, makes the water transport channel with being connected outside the tube wall, in installation fitting,
Directly fitting connections are inserted in the mounting hole, realize Fast Installation;
Further improve, reinforcings taken equipped with color layer, as iridescent, yellow, blueness, red one kind therein or
The varicolored combination of person, can be used for alerting persons not damage the agricultural irrigation braiding water delivery soft ribbons, also have
Beneficial in operation in the case that night or light are bad, the position of band is reinforced in clear identification, installation fitting is more convenient soon
It is prompt;
Beneficial effect:The tube wall of the present invention includes braiding layer and liner layer, and braiding layer is located at liner layer periphery, with existing skill
Art is compared, and under same caliber, wall thickness is thin, light-weight, cost is low, is easily portable and transports;The weft of braiding layer is by fibrous layer structure
Into improving the pliabilitys of agricultural irrigation braiding water delivery soft ribbons, wearability, resistance to pressure and lower temperature resistance, good weatherability, easy disk
Volume, stacking occupied ground is small, easily storage;Warp is made of flat filament layer, in farmland in use, avoiding the water delivery of polyethylene material soft
Band occurs due to the temperature difference phenomenon that causes to expand with heat and contract with cold and influences water delivery effect;Liner layer uses multi-layer body coextruded layer, wherein one
Layer entity coextruded layer is closely connected with braiding layer, will not be because of external worlds such as external force, temperature when such braiding layer is connected with liner layer
The influence of factor makes liner layer damage or even perforates, while improves the pliability of liner layer, makes the water sealing effect of spigot-and-socket accessory
More preferably, drainage will not be produced.According to water-saving irrigation Co., Ltd of Xingjiang Tianye Co. company standard detection performance contrast such as following table:

Embodiment
Embodiment 1, agricultural irrigation braiding water delivery soft ribbons, including tube wall 1 and the water transport channel 2 formed by tube wall 1, it is described
Tube wall 1 includes braiding layer 3 and liner layer 4, is equipped between the braiding layer 3 and the liner layer 4 and reinforces band 5, the braiding layer 3
4 periphery of liner layer is located at, the braiding layer 3, the reinforcing band 5 and the liner layer 4 are by the close connection of heat bonding;Institute
State braiding layer 3 to be made of warp 6 and the braiding of weft 7, the warp 6 is by two layers of plastic PE flat filament layer 6-1 and PE flat filament layer 6-2 structures
Into the weft 7 is made of one layer of polypropylene fiber silk layer 7-1, and the liner layer 4 is the two layers of plastic formed using coextrusion process
Entity coextruded layer, one layer is EVA entities coextruded layer 8, and in addition one layer is PE entities coextruded layer 9, and the PE entities coextruded layer 9 is formed
The water transport channel 2, the PE flat filaments layer 6-1 and the EVA entities coextruded layer 8 close to 8 side of EVA entities coextruded layer
Heat bonding is close to be connected, and in addition one layer of PE flat filament layers 6-2 has the function that the protection liner layer 4;
The liner layer thickness is 0.1mm;
The braiding layer thickness is 0.1mm;
The reinforcing tape thickness is 0.1mm, width 50mm.
Intensity of the present invention is higher, and wearability is good, and resistance to hydrostatic pressure and anticracking pressure are all fine, can be widely applied to agricultural
Irrigation field and industry, mine drainage system.
Embodiment 2, difference from Example 1 is:
The liner layer thickness is 0.8mm;
The braiding layer thickness is 1.0mm;
The reinforcing tape thickness is 1.0mm, width 20mm.
Embodiment 3, difference from Example 1 is:
The liner layer thickness is 0.6mm;
The braiding layer thickness is 0.3mm;
The reinforcing tape thickness is 0.5mm, width 100mm.
Embodiment 4, difference from Example 1 is:
The liner layer thickness is 0.2mm;
The braiding layer thickness is 0.6mm;
The reinforcing tape thickness is 0.7mm, width 80mm.
